Products should be designed to reflect what the customer needs and hence marketers who understand customer needs, design engineers and manufacturers must work together to make the product. House of quality provides a conceptual map for planning and communicating between the various functions involved (marketing, design and manufacturing). Consumers can mean multiple things when they look for quality in a product. It is not possible to satisfy all that the consumers want. Hence, customer experience feedback should be constantly taken, and this should be communicated with the engineers so that they can build products that meets customer expectations. The needs of the customers can be referred to as customer attributes (CAs). While designing a product, the CAs need to be considered and different weightage should be given to CAs since some attributes are considered more important than others by the customers. By looking at how the consumers’ view our competitors’ products solve the CAs against ours, we can find out areas which are not explored by others and use it to our advantage by providing it, as well as use our strong areas to position the brand. Each engineering change of product will lead to affecting the CA in either positive or negative way. The factors which the engineering team changes are engineering characteristics (ECs). We must perform those ECs which has a strong positive impact on meeting CAs. For a CA, we must identify the EC which will affect it and for that EC, we must objectively measure how customers view our competitors’ products and based on that, we must set the targets for our changes. Understanding House of Quality helps people to think in right direction and thinking together.
Reading 2: Steve Jobs: Chapter 12 – The Design
“God is in the details” and “Less is More” – Similar to the maxims, the design of products should be clear and expressive. Jobs ensured that Apple’s products were clean and simple, and followed the idea “Simplicity is the ultimate sophistication”. The products should be made easy to use. It should be intuitively obvious to the user on how to use the product. The calligraphy class Jobs audited at Reed inspired him to develop different fonts for the Mac. Something which he learned came back to him during font designing and he connected the dots to make it successful. Careful design should be done even to parts which are hidden away from consumers’ normal view. Consumers judge a book by its cover and hence the product packaging must be made appealing. Work should be done with passion with a playful / whimsical attitude at times because only when we treat our products with passion, do they turn out to be like art that gets liked and admired.
Reading 3: Steve Jobs: Chapter 26 – Design Principles
The aim of an organization is not to chase after profits, but to focus on making great products. This will lead to decisions which will transform the product designs. “Less but better” and “Simplicity is the ultimate sophistication” – Jobs believed that simplicity came from understanding the complexities clearly and coming up with elegant solutions rather than ignoring them. For making an elegant product, we should understand the functioning of its parts in depth and then remove the non-essential parts. Design of a product is not just in how it looks but is based on how it functioned within.
